jds SVN: spec-files
Laszlo (Laca) Peter
laca at sun.com
Wed Apr 4 08:48:32 PDT 2007
I don't see why we shouldn't ship this.
The ABI incompatibility issue is with libraries implemented in
C++, and not with C++ wrappers for libraries implemented in C.
Laca
On Wed, 2007-04-04 at 22:41 +0800, Irene (Shi Ying) Huang wrote:
> laca
>
> attached is the enchant++.h file, it simply contain an C++ wrapper of
> the enchant C APIs exported by libenchant.so.
>
> Thanks
>
> --Irene
> On Wed, 2007-04-04 at 10:07 -0400, Laszlo (Laca) Peter wrote:
> > On Wed, 2007-04-04 at 21:36 +0800, Harry Lu wrote:
> > > I think the reason is that currently no components in JDS are using the
> > > C++ interface of enchant. And because of the concerns on C++'s ABI
> > > problem, we decided not to provide it.
> > >
> > > Or could we ship a C++ shared library in JDS?
> >
> > Okay, so this commit removes a header that belongs to a library
> > that we do not ship? It wasn't clear from the ChangeLog and
> > should have been discussed whether to ship the C++ interface
> > or not.
> >
> > Laca
> >
> > > On Wed, 2007-04-04 at 09:07 -0400, Laszlo (Laca) Peter wrote:
> > > > On Tue, 2007-04-03 at 23:40 -0700, Irene.Huang at Sun.COM wrote:
> > > > > 2007-04-04 Irene Huang <irene.huang at sun.com>
> > > > >
> > > > > * base-specs/enchant.spec: Remove file
> > > > > /usr/include/enchant/enchant++.h.
> > > >
> > > > Why?
> > > >
> > > >
> > >
> >
More information about the jds-notify
mailing list